    Understanding the Quaking Aspen

    Defining Characteristics

    Quaking aspens, scientifically known as Populus tremuloides, are deciduous trees recognized for their unique characteristics. One distinctive feature of quaking aspens is their iconic trembling leaves. These leaves have flat petioles, allowing them to flutter and quake in the slightest breeze, creating a mesmerizing visual effect. Another defining trait of quaking aspens is their white bark with distinct black knots, offering a striking contrast in forest landscapes.

    Habitat and Distribution

    Quaking aspens are well-adapted to various habitats across North America, particularly thriving in regions with plenty of sunlight. These resilient trees commonly populate areas with moist soils, such as stream banks or valleys. They are prevalent in regions with moderate to cold climates, including parts of Canada, the United States, and Mexico. Quaking aspens form expansive colonies through a unique system of root sprouting, often creating vast stands of genetically identical trees, known as clones, interconnected underground. This interconnected root system enables quaking aspens to reproduce asexually and rapidly colonize new areas, showcasing their remarkable adaptability.

    How Do Quaking Aspen Trees Reproduce?

    Asexual Reproduction: Root Suckering

    Quaking aspen trees reproduce asexually through a process known as root suckering. In this method, new tree shoots sprout from the extensive root system of existing trees, creating genetically identical clones interconnected underground. These root suckers emerge near the parent tree, forming clusters that share the same genetic makeup. As the roots spread, they give rise to new stems, allowing quaking aspens to rapidly establish colonies that are essentially identical copies of the parent tree. This efficient reproduction strategy contributes to the widespread presence of quaking aspens across various habitats in North America, showcasing their adaptability and ability to thrive in diverse environments.

    Sexual Reproduction: Seed Dispersal

    In addition to asexual reproduction, quaking aspen trees also reproduce sexually through seed dispersal. This process involves the development of catkins, which are clusters of flowers that contain both male and female reproductive organs. The male flowers release pollen, which is carried by the wind to pollinate the female flowers on neighboring trees. Once pollinated, the female flowers develop into seeds that are housed in capsules, which eventually scatter seeds to the surrounding areas. Seed dispersal allows for genetic variation among quaking aspen populations, promoting diversity and adaptation to changing environmental conditions. While asexual reproduction leads to genetically identical clones, sexual reproduction introduces variation that enhances the resilience and evolutionary success of quaking aspen forests.

    The Role of Environment in Aspen Reproduction

    When it comes to the reproduction of quaking aspen trees, the environment plays a crucial role. Here’s how different environmental factors impact the reproduction of these fascinating trees:

    Impact of Climate Conditions

    The climate has a significant influence on how quaking aspen trees reproduce. As a species known for its adaptability, these trees thrive in various climates but have specific requirements for successful reproduction. Here’s how climate conditions affect aspen reproduction:

    • Temperature: Quaking aspens prefer temperate climates with distinct seasons. They rely on cold temperatures for dormancy during winter and warm temperatures for growth during the growing season. Extreme temperature fluctuations can affect the timing of flowering and seed development.
    • Precipitation: Adequate water availability is crucial for aspen reproduction. Precipitation patterns, including rainfall and snowmelt, impact seed germination, root development, and overall tree health. Drought conditions can hinder successful reproduction by affecting seedling survival rates.
    • Sunlight: Quaking aspens are light-demanding trees that require sufficient sunlight for growth and reproduction. Shaded areas may inhibit seedling establishment and growth, affecting the overall reproductive success of aspen stands.

    Understanding how climate conditions influence aspen reproduction can help you appreciate the resilience of these trees in adapting to different environmental challenges.

    Effects of Soil and Water Availability

    Aside from climate, soil quality and water availability also play vital roles in the reproduction of quaking aspen trees. Here’s how these factors impact the success of aspen reproduction:

    • Soil Composition: Quaking aspens thrive in well-drained soils with good aeration. Soil compaction can limit root growth and spread, impacting the ability of aspen clones to establish interconnected root systems. Additionally, nutrient-rich soils support healthy growth and reproduction, contributing to the resilience of aspen colonies.
    • Water Availability: Adequate water supply is essential for the germination of aspen seeds and the growth of root systems. Insufficient water availability can limit the establishment of new aspen stands and hinder the expansion of existing colonies. Wetland areas provide optimal conditions for aspen growth, promoting successful reproduction through root suckering.

    Challenges Facing Aspen Reproduction

    Threats from Pests and Diseases

    Aspen trees face challenges from various pests and diseases that can impact their reproductive success. Pests like aphids, leaf miners, and tent caterpillars can defoliate aspen stands, reducing their ability to photosynthesize and store energy for reproduction. These pests can weaken the trees, making them more vulnerable to diseases like Cytospora canker, a fungal infection that affects the bark and can lead to tree dieback.

    To mitigate the threats from pests and diseases, it’s essential to monitor the health of aspen stands regularly. Implementing integrated pest management strategies can help control pest populations without harming beneficial insects or the environment. Proper pruning and removal of infected branches can also prevent the spread of diseases within the stand, preserving the reproductive potential of the aspen trees.

    Challenges Posed by Human Activity

    Human activities pose significant challenges to aspen reproduction across their habitats. Forest fragmentation due to urbanization, agriculture, and infrastructure development can isolate aspen stands, limiting genetic diversity and the exchange of pollen between trees. This fragmentation can hinder successful sexual reproduction and reduce the overall resilience of aspen populations.

    Moreover, logging practices and land use changes can directly impact aspen habitats, leading to habitat loss and degradation. Clearcutting and improper forest management practices can disrupt the natural regeneration process of aspen stands, hindering both their asexual and sexual reproduction mechanisms.

    To address the challenges posed by human activity, sustainable land management practices are crucial. Implementing conservation strategies such as habitat restoration, reforestation efforts, and promoting connectivity between aspen stands can help preserve and enhance the reproductive capacity of aspen trees in the face of ongoing human disruptions.

    Conservation Efforts for Quaking Aspen

    Restoration Projects

    Restoration projects play a vital role in preserving quaking aspen populations. These initiatives focus on restoring degraded aspen stands, enhancing habitat quality, and promoting biodiversity. By replanting native aspen trees in areas affected by deforestation or human activities, restoration projects help maintain the ecological balance and provide suitable environments for aspen regeneration.

    Importance of Genetic Diversity

    Genetic diversity is crucial for the long-term survival of quaking aspen trees. Maintaining a diverse genetic pool within aspen populations enhances resilience to environmental stressors, pests, and diseases. Conservation efforts often prioritize the protection of genetically diverse aspen stands to ensure the sustainability of these iconic trees. By preserving genetic variability, we can safeguard the adaptive potential of quaking aspens for future generations.
